FAQs

What is the lifespan of this bulb?

The bulb has a lifespan of approximately 10,000 hours.

Is this bulb dimmable?

No, this bulb is not dimmable.

What type of base does this bulb have?

This bulb has an E27 base.

What is the energy efficiency rating?

The bulb has an A+ energy efficiency rating.

What color of light does this bulb emit?

This bulb emits warm white light.

How bright is this bulb?

The bulb provides 806 lumens.

Troubleshooting

Bulb doesn't turn on.

Check the power supply to the fixture. Ensure the bulb is screwed in correctly and is not loose. Try a different bulb in the same fixture to rule out a fixture issue.

Bulb flickers.

The bulb is not compatible with a dimmer switch. Ensure it is not connected to a dimmer circuit. Replace the bulb.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

  1. Installation: Ensure the power is turned off before replacing the bulb. Screw the E27 base bulb into the fixture until it is snug. Do not overtighten.
  2. Compatibility: This bulb is compatible with fixtures that use an E27 base. It is *not* compatible with dimmable fixtures.
  3. Care: Avoid contact with liquids. Clean the bulb with a dry cloth when necessary. Handle with care to prevent damage.
